Transaction 1867bfba2987476961363c376670055855d421db3c93a7a12b3d8d86833935b4

1 Input
2 Outputs
  • 1867bfba2987476961363c376670055855d421db3c93a7a12b3d8d86833935b4:0
  • value  10570000
    address  1P3UsD6mXSGncgpLKxTX1kr2Be11rLT27o
  • 1867bfba2987476961363c376670055855d421db3c93a7a12b3d8d86833935b4:1
  • value  23517655046
    address  1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9